The fourth Ukraine Recovery Conference (URC2025) will convene in Rome, Italy, from 10 to 11 July, marking a significant event in the international community’s response to the ongoing conflict in Ukraine. This annual conference serves as a critical platform for discussing and coordinating recovery efforts following the full-scale Russian invasion that began in 2022. The event will bring together representatives from governments, international organizations, and financial institutions to present their respective plans and commitments toward Ukraine’s reconstruction and economic stabilization.
Expected to be attended by high-level officials from various countries, the conference aims to secure additional funding, resources, and support for Ukraine. Discussions will likely focus on infrastructure rehabilitation, economic resilience, humanitarian aid, and long-term sustainability for the war-torn nation. With the global community increasingly aware of the humanitarian and economic repercussions of the conflict, the URC2025 will be a pivotal moment in shaping the trajectory of Ukraine’s recovery and its integration into the international financial system.
